In recent weeks, Nyxoah SA (NYXH) has exhibited a notable pullback, with shares declining 4.10% in the latest session to trade at $2.81. The stock is testing lower support near $2.67, a level that has historically attracted buying interest, while overhead resistance at $2.95 caps near-term upside. T
